-From: Felix Fietkau <nbd@nbd.name>
-Date: Wed, 25 Jan 2017 12:57:05 +0100
-Subject: [PATCH] ath9k: rename tx_complete_work to hw_check_work
-
-Also include common MAC alive check. This should make the hang checks
-more reliable for modes where beacons are not sent and is used as a
-starting point for further hang check improvements
-
-Signed-off-by: Felix Fietkau <nbd@nbd.name>
